A Children’s AI Toy Exposed Thousands of Private Conversations
A disturbing security breach has emerged in the rapidly growing market of AI-powered smart toys. Bondu, a company that manufactures a talking dinosaur toy for children, inadvertently exposed the private information of over 50,000 kids online. The data—including personal conversations, names, birth dates, and family details—was left completely unprotected on the internet. Shockingly, anyone with a standard Google account could access this sensitive information without needing a password or any hacking skills.
How the Vulnerability Was Discovered
The incident came to light when a security researcher named Joseph Thacker was alerted by his neighbor, who had recently ordered the AI dinosaur toys for her children. Acting out of caution, Thacker decided to examine the toy’s underlying system. What he found was alarming. He did not need to break into the system; he simply logged in using his own Google account, and the private records of thousands of children appeared before him. No advanced techniques or tools were required.
What Data Was Exposed
The leaked database contained far more than just names and birth dates. It also recorded the nicknames children lovingly gave their toys. Beyond that, the system stored deeply personal details: children’s favorite snacks, their dance moves, and their innocent thoughts and ideas. Even the goals or targets that parents had set for their children were openly visible. Thacker described the experience as deeply unsettling, stating that seeing children’s private conversations so easily accessible was a massive violation of their privacy.
The Risk of Child Exploitation
Security expert Joel Margolis has characterized this negligence as a golden opportunity for predators. He warns that the exposed information could easily be used by malicious individuals to manipulate or endanger a child. These toys are designed to learn a child’s preferences and habits in order to create a detailed profile, enabling more natural conversations. However, when that profile falls into the wrong hands, it becomes a serious safety threat. The data provides a complete blueprint of a child’s personality, making it simple for someone with bad intentions to gain their trust.
The Company’s Response and Technical Shortcomings
Fatin Anam Rafid, the owner of Bondu, stated that once the flaw was brought to his attention, it was fixed within a few hours. However, experts believe the root cause lies in how the toy’s software was developed. It is suspected that the company relied heavily on AI coding tools to build the system. While such tools accelerate development, they often produce code that lacks robust security measures.

A Hollow Safety Promise
Ironically, Bondu had publicly claimed that its toy was completely secure. The company even went so far as to offer a reward of $500 (approximately 40,000 INR) to anyone who could make the toy say something inappropriate or offensive. This was presented as proof of their commitment to safety.
Thacker, however, dismisses this as meaningless. He argues that when a child’s entire personal history and all their conversations are already exposed online, it does not matter whether the toy itself speaks politely or not. The real danger lies not in what the toy says, but in the data that has already been compromised.
